Spring Clean-Up April 19th

Our annual Spring Clean-Up is happening this Sunday morning (April 19th from 9am to 12pm). We've got a number of projects happening around the centre plus there will be snacks and refreshments on our lakeside patio.

Whether you can come for the whole morning or just a part of it, everyone's help is greatly appreciated. Clean-up is always great for connecting with other members.

Some of the projects planned for this year's clean-up include:

  • Creating planters for along the Abbott Street fence.
  • Assembling a new boat rack to create additional storage spaces.
  • Weeding and planting the gardens around the clubhouse.
  • Cleaning and seasonal maintenance for the KPC boats & boards.
  • Filling in the sandy depressions in the parking lot.

By the end of the morning the centre should be looking sharp and be ready to welcome both members and the community to come paddle this season!

New Member Orientations

Every Saturday & Sunday at 10am

Orientations for new members are available starting this Sunday April 19th at 10am and continuing on weekends throughout the season. Orientation takes about twenty minutes and includes essential information for accessing the centre & equipment plus a review of safety info and personalized program recommendations.

Coach Eric Mitchell

June 6 to 14

Coach Eric Mitchell return to KPC this spring. Eric has worked with some of the world's best outrigger crews in developing their paddling technique.

During Eric's visit this season we will have clinics and private lessons available for OC6 crews and individual paddlers. Eric is already preparing for his trip - crews are invited to submit video and notes for him to review before he arrives at KPC.
